ULTRA provides applications for and capabilities in Contact Center Quality, Enterprise Transaction Management, Customer Xperience(TM) Management and Customer Intelligence Analytics(TM), components for Building the Customer-Intelligent Enterprise(TM). The Customer-Intelligent Enterprise reaches beyond the concept of Customer Relationship Management (CRM) to managing the entire business based on intelligence about the customers. While traditional CRM focuses on the specific need of one customer at a time, Comverse Infosys has developed ways of leveraging the feedback of all customers to increase customer loyalty, improve retention and maximize revenues and profits.

About Comverse Technology, Inc.

Comverse Technology, Inc., headquartered in Woodbury, New York, designs, develops, manufactures and markets computer and telecommunications systems and software for communications and information processing applications. In addition to its Infosys Division, Comverse's operations include: Comverse Network Systems Division, which is the world's leading supplier of systems and software enabling network-based enhanced services; and Ulticom, which is a leading provider of network signaling software for wireless, wireline, and Internet communication services. Comverse Technology is an S&P 500 and NASDAQ-100 Index company. Visit Comverse Technology's web site at http://www.cmvt.com.
